I even take classes right now to find my English of my 20 years. :-D So, start by clicking on the elements panel before the first Parallax image (ID WEd5a2dfb812 and bearing the name of PANNEAU_SLIDER). Then go to the right menu, Styles tab and then Customize. Click the arrow next to Background. Here's how to set up another elements panel (or a frame or whatever you want with a background image). Then click on the Properties tab (still in the right menu). You will see at the bottom a custom classes: parallax This code refers to the Parallax Safe element. Remember that the image must be taller than the size of the element panel, otherwise the parallax effect will not work. Have I answered your question correctly? |
